I create many documents using the draw feature to insert lines, triangles
and more complicated diagrams.
My preferences are to display the grid and have gridlines set at a distance
of 0.2cm apart for both horizontal and vertical spacing.
I will continually use the 'Drawing Grid' diaglogue box (activate by
pressing Draw on the Drawing toolbar and selecting Grid...) to check and
uncheck the preferences "snap objects to grid" and "snap object to other
objects" as is convenient in my current project.
I have had the following problem occur with several different computer
(laptops/desktops) loaded with Word 2003. Everything has been fine until
suddenly, one day, I open up a new document, switch the grid on and check the
'snap objects to grid', but the lines and shapes I draw are not attached to
the grid. In fact, they are offset by a certain amount. If I select the
object and move it around using the arrow keys, it will jump in increments,
but the spacing is not the grid spacing either!
Even more peculiarly, if I re-open previous documents for which everything
was working correctly, everything continues to work correctly, so it can't be
a screen resolution issue. The drawing tools were working perfectly until
now!
I have tried repairing and completely reinstalling the Office software, but
the problem remains as described in the previous paragraphs.
I have also tried messing around with the Normal template, deleting it from
the drive and seeing if a new one is created that fixes the problem, but this
is to no avail.
I am eager for any solutions to this glitch that has come my way. As I have
said, this has occurred on several computers, including the one I use at my
work over the network - so I doubt it is a machine-configuration specific
problem.
